While I peacefully stared out into the horizon, my legs kicked furiously beneath the water. The unbroken surface hid the fear. Self-preservation was strong within me but I knew my duty. The goddess needed young blood from a man. Our fishing village’s future was in my hands. I prayed that there would be fish to feed my family tomorrow. I would tread water until she consumed me. Staring out, waiting for her, I cried.
